What are good foods to eat with acid reflux?

According to WebMD, people who suffer from acid reflux should eat a diet rich with low acid foods. These foods will alkalize the stomach and help reduce acid reflux symptoms.
WebMD states that low acid foods are foods that have a high pH. The higher the pH value of a food, the less acidic. People suffering from acid reflux disease should aim to eat foods with pH values above 5. Examples of low acid foods include whole grain breads; brown rice; green vegetables such as broccoli, green beans and celery; potatoes; fish; and egg whites. All of these foods are low in acid if eaten, boiled or baked. Foods that are fried are likely to cause acid reflux symptoms.
